Output 3efd306955cfdb689251e5c972532640a8d0ed2fd074bb6c23f0f11beb3e7d26:0

value
36769775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908cf4fbb2fa7a6db6e7be596d0eaee6e38551a4 OP_EQUAL
address
3EsL62dpdb5eS3uR9TYAzZ3KT7psHweofQ
transaction
3efd306955cfdb689251e5c972532640a8d0ed2fd074bb6c23f0f11beb3e7d26
spent
true